I love the boondocks, read it everyday, it somehow makes my already dull day brighter. But anyway, i read that each character is a representation of the types of black men, for example Huey is the millitant brotha, named after Huey P Newton, and Freeman from Sam Greenlee's "Spook who sat by the door" umm Riley is, the wanna be gansta hard ****, Grandpa, well i don't know who grandpa really is supposed to be, Uncle Rukus is the Uncle Tom Clarence Thomas, type dude.
